Marion County Arrest Report for Wednesday April 1, 2026
Charges include failure to appear, driving under the influence, and drug paraphernalia
Apr. 1, 2026 at 11:20am
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
The Marion County Sheriff's Office has released its arrest report for Wednesday, April 1, 2026, detailing charges against several individuals in the region. The report includes charges such as failure to appear, driving under the influence, and possession of drug paraphernalia.
Why it matters
The arrest report provides insight into the types of crimes and offenses occurring in the Marion County area, which can help inform public safety efforts and community discussions around law enforcement and the criminal justice system.
The details
The report lists 10 individuals who were arrested or detained by various law enforcement agencies in Marion County and surrounding areas. Charges include failure to appear, resisting arrest, driving under the influence, drug-related offenses, and probation violations. The arrestees range in age from 26 to 50 years old and come from towns like Griffin, Whitwell, Sequatchie, and Bridgeport.
- The arrests occurred between March 28 and March 31, 2026.
